程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> Oracle數據庫 >> 關於Oracle數據庫 >> Oracle數據庫設置任務計劃備份一周的備份記錄

Oracle數據庫設置任務計劃備份一周的備份記錄

編輯:關於Oracle數據庫

       Oracle 數據庫備份:

      --保留最近一周的備份記錄;

      ====正文:

      ====開始==============

      echo 設置備份文件存放文件夾...

      set "tbuf=E:Cwaybackup"

      echo 設置備份文件名(以星期幾命名,即備份文件只保存最近一周)...

      set name=%date%

      set name=%name:~-3%

      set name=ORCL_backup_%name%

      echo 是否存在同名文件,若存在則刪除同名文件...

      if exist %tbuf%%name%.dmp del %tbuf%%name%.dmp

      if exist %tbuf%%name%.log del %tbuf%%name%.log

      echo 開始備份XX項目 Oracle 數據庫.....

      exp User1/PassWord1@Orcl file=%tbuf%%name%.dmp log='%tbuf%%name%.log'

      echo 備份完畢!

      ===結束=======

      ==將“開始”,“結束”之間的內容復制到txt文件中,修改相應的參數如:路徑、數據庫名稱等;

      另存為bat格式,創建任務計劃,設置每天運行即可實現數據庫備份。

      注:

      (1)User:要備份數據的用戶名;

      (2)PassWord:口令;

      (3)Orcl:數據庫名稱;

    1. 上一頁:
    2. 下一頁:
    Copyright © 程式師世界 All Rights Reserved